Chesapeake & Potomac Softball
The Chesapeake and Potomac Softball League (CAPS) is a 501(3)(c) non-profit organization founded...
Read MoreThe Chesapeake and Potomac Softball League (CAPS) is a 501(3)(c) non-profit organization founded...
Read More